Thylacinus yorkellus is a fossil species of carnivorous marsupial, a sister species of the recently extinct Thylacinus cynocephalus , the Tasmanian tiger, both of which existed on mainland Australia.

Taxonomy

A species described by Adam Yates, published in 2015, emerging from a study of the left dentary of a thylacinid obtained at the Curramulka fossil site in South Australia. The holotype had been examined by Neville Pledge, who remarked on the possibility of a new species in 1992. [2]

The specific epithet combines the name of the region it was discovered, the Yorke Peninsula, and the Latin ellus, a diminutive suffix that denotes a species that was smaller than Thylacinus cynocephalus . [1]

Description

holotype, three views of the incomplete left dentary Thylacinus yorkellus.jpg
holotype, three views of the incomplete left dentary

A comparatively small species of Thylacinus that is known to have existed during the late Miocene epoch. The author of the species suggests that evidence supports the species existing during that later Pliocene. The holotype of the species, the dentary, retains the three pemolars, two of four molars, the canine, and alveoli of the incisor and missing second molar. The specimen was broken at the third molar, so presents no evidence of the fourth. [1]

An estimated weight for two known specimens, calculated with regression functions applied to dasyuromorphian data, is noted as 17.8 and 15.9 kilograms. The average body mass of T. cynocephalus was greater than this estimate, around 30 kg, and the species was much smaller than range of estimated weights, 38.7 to 57.3 kg, for Thylacinus potens and Thylacinus megiriani . The thylacine is an extinct carnivorous marsupial that was native to the Australian mainland and the islands of Tasmania and New Guinea. It was one of the largest known carnivorous marsupials, evolving about 2 million years ago. The last known live animal was captured in 1930 in Tasmania. It is commonly known as the Tasmanian tiger or the Tasmanian wolf. Various Aboriginal Tasmanian names have been recorded, such as coorinna, kanunnah, cab-berr-one-nen-er, loarinna, laoonana, can-nen-ner and lagunta, while kaparunina is used in the constructed language of Palawa kani.

Thylacinus potens was the largest species of the family Thylacinidae, originally known from a single poorly preserved fossil discovered by Michael O. Woodburne in 1967 in a Late Miocene locality near Alice Springs, Northern Territory. It preceded the most recent species of thylacine by 4–6 million years, and was 5% bigger, was more robust and had a shorter, broader skull. Its size is estimated to be similar to that of a grey wolf; the head and body together were around 5 feet long, and its teeth were less adapted for shearing compared to those of the now-extinct thylacine.

Microleo attenboroughi is a very small species of the Thylacoleonidae family from the Early Miocene of Australia, living in the wet forest that dominated Riversleigh about 18 million years ago. The genus Microleo is currently known from a broken palate and two pieces of jaw, containing some teeth and roots that correspond to those found in other species of thylacoleonids. The shape and structure of the blade-like P3 tooth, a premolar, distinguished the species as a new genus. It was found in Early Miocene-aged deposits of the Riversleigh fossil site in Queensland, regarded as one of the most significant palaeontological sites yet discovered, and named for the naturalist David Attenborough in appreciation of his support for its heritage listing. The anatomy of Microleo suggests the genus is basal to all the known thylacoleonids, known as the marsupial lions, although its relative size prompted a discover to describe it as the "feisty" kitten of the family.
